Honestly they didn't really take much advantage of using the computer at all, and it seemed very basic. There are lot of better gaming experiences including the old "choose your own adventure" style RPG books that didn't use a computer at all, and yet offered something better than what seems to essentially boils down to snakes and ladders with a bit more RNG. They could have easily drawn from things like DnD to make this a much more involved experience that better used the computer.
Also putting it brutally, making the claims about the music, but then having you stream an album you have to buy just seems half baked.
In a nutshell, too simple, and using the C64 for the sake of it, rather than any practical reason. D- Must try harder.
